Tawag Pinoy for the iPhone!

Many Pinoys walk around with as many as three separate phone numbers, and it’s even more difficult keeping track of which number to call and maximizing the promos and contests offered by telecoms.

This is where Tawag Pinoy comes in, an address book app that organizes and simplifies your iPhone address book info in an elegantly designed and friendly user interface. For the iPod Touch, its features are limited to organizing one’s contacts.
